Transaction 61d160004333ca068a3a381f984ea782cc6808789550e678bc566ba49c9dcc16
2 Input
2 Outputs
- 61d160004333ca068a3a381f984ea782cc6808789550e678bc566ba49c9dcc16:0
- 61d160004333ca068a3a381f984ea782cc6808789550e678bc566ba49c9dcc16:1
value 1029100
address 128kVaXvdxqZ7ngf57iXi82PzRBf6v2AZC
value 2340000
address 17QNXefC8Cm9EUitzr3G6SsFr5rVfwLHyo